Copyright law is confusing. Can I use copyrighted materials in my course? What are the appropriate channels to acquire and distribute copyrighted materials? This session will go over copyright basics and also give you additional help resources.
The first portion of the session is an overview of copyright essentials and helpful resources.
The final 20 minutes of the workshop is devoted to answering your questions.
This workshop is a partnership between the University Libraries, the Media and Design Studio, and Northwestern IT Teaching & Learning Technologies.
